What's Happening?
As 2026 progresses, certain gifting trends have emerged, with a focus on collectibles, offline hobbies, Korean skincare, and retro-themed items. Popular gifts include the Buddha Board, a mess-free art board, and the NeeDoh squishy toy. These items have gained
traction on social media platforms like TikTok, influencing consumer behavior and driving sales. The trend towards retro and collectible items reflects a broader cultural nostalgia and a desire for tangible, offline experiences in a digital age. This shift is evident in the popularity of products that encourage creativity and relaxation, appealing to a wide range of age groups.
